E160: Stop Lamenting: How Great Leaders Move From Complaining to Solving

from Getting Results with Dr. Jean · host Dr. Jean, The Results Queen®

Dr. Jean, The Results Queen® tackles a common leadership trap she calls leadership lamenting: the habit of complaining, judging, and focusing on problems instead of solutions. As a coach to business owners, managing partners, and executive leaders, Dr. Jean sees it all the time. Leaders spend valuable time venting about employees, partners, challenges, and circumstances, but rarely realize how much energy and momentum they lose in the process. Complaining may feel good in the moment, but it does not grow the business. Dr. Jean explains how this behavior is rooted in Caveman Brain®, our hardwired survival instincts that constantly judge threats and reinforce negativity. Then she shares practical methods to break the cycle and train your brain to shift from breakdown thinking to breakthrough thinking. This episode is a masterclass in emotional discipline, critical thinking, and leadership maturity.
